Water Market Sector Leader
Key Responsibilities
- Develop and execute strategies to expand market share in the water sector.
- Lead initiatives to enhance stakeholder relationships and partnerships within the water industry.
- Oversee the implementation of projects that address water management and supply challenges.
- Provide expert guidance on regulatory compliance and policy advocacy related to water markets.
What you'll need
- A minimum of 10 years of experience in water resources management or related field.
- Proven track record of successful project leadership and team management.
- Strong understanding of water law, policy, and regulatory frameworks.
- Excellent communication and negotiation skills.
- Ability to manage multiple projects simultaneously and meet tight deadlines.
